The concept of complex rays plays an important role in wave-propagation modelling. In this study we describe an efficient method for complex ray tracing. Our objective is to facilitate generalization of this concept to wave-propagation studies in general inhomogeneous media. By solving rigorously the complex eikonal equation arising from medium anelasticity, we strive to provide an accurate description of the wave-attenuation process in a realistic earth structure. to enhance practical utility of our method, we have developed a ray-perturbation scheme which keeps the computation to a minimum. A further advantage of our approach is that it can be used to extend the technique of complex source point to general inhomogeneous media. the said extension overcomes the singularity problem encountered by asymptotic ray theory near a caustic and is capable of modelling evanescent waves.
